Having looked at the excellent Multi-Library plugin I still found this
a bit "Overkill" and it does need the music to be tagged whereas I have
a LOT of FLAC music not all of it tagged. 

So the EASY way (Windows) is simply in the main music folder is to
create "Shortcuts" to the other folders on different (including
Networked) drives

For instance I might have my main Library on Disk H:\Audio

Now I might have a collection of BACH keyboard works on Disk E in
E\MUSIC\BACH_KEYBOARD


so in the primary library just create a shortcut to
E:\MUSIC\BACH_KEYBOARD

Now when you browse your music folder with your squeeze controller you
will see an entry for BACH_KEYBOARD. When you select that it will give
you the listing of the music in the folder on DISK E.

Bit of a work around but its simple.


On Linux you can do the same - just create SYMLINKS
